2010-05-13 | CVE-2010-1281 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Adobe Shockwave Player iml32.dll in Adobe Shockwave Player before 11.5.7.609 does not validate a certain value from a file before using it in file-pointer calculations,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via a crafted .dir (aka Director) file. | 8.8 |
2010-05-13 | CVE-2010-1280 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Adobe Shockwave Player Adobe Shockwave Player before 11.5.7.609 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via a crafted .dir (aka Director) file, related to (1) an erroneous dereference and (2) a certain Shock.dir file. | 9.3 |
2010-05-13 | CVE-2010-0987 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Adobe Shockwave Player Heap-based buffer overflow in Adobe Shockwave Player before 11.5.7.609 might all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ted embedded fonts in a Shockwave file. | 8.8 |
2010-05-13 | CVE-2010-0986 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Adobe Shockwave Player Adobe Shockwave Player before 11.5.7.609 does not properly process asset entries,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ory corruption) or poss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ted Shockwave file. | 8.8 |
2010-05-13 | CVE-2010-0128 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Adobe Director and Shockwave Player Integer signedness error in dirapi.dll in Adobe Shockwave Player before 11.5.7.609 and Adobe Director before 11.5.7.609 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ory corruption) or poss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ted .dir file that triggers an invalid read operation. | 9.3 |
2010-05-13 | CVE-2010-0127 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Adobe Shockwave Player Adobe Shockwave Player before 11.5.7.609 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via crafted FFFFFF45h Shockwave 3D blocks in a Shockwave file. | 8.8 |
2010-05-07 | CVE-2010-1451 | Out-Of-Bounds Write vulnerability in multiple products The TSB I-TLB load implementation in arch/sparc/kernel/tsb.S in the Linux kernel before 2.6.33 on the SPARC platform does not properly obtain the value of a certain _PAGE_EXEC_4U bit and consequently does not properly implement a non-executable stack, which makes it easier for context-dependent attackers to exploit stack-based buffer overflows via a crafted application. | 2.1 |
2010-02-16 | CVE-2009-2950 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in multiple products Heap-based buffer overflow in the GIFLZWDecompressor::GIFLZWDecompressor function in filter.vcl/lgif/decode.cxx in OpenOffice.org (OOo) before 3.2 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ted GIF file, related to LZW decompression. | 9.3 |
2010-01-13 | CVE-2009-3953 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in multiple products The U3D implementation in Adobe Reader and Acrobat 9.x before 9.3, 8.x before 8.2 on Windows and Mac OS X, and 7.x before 7.1.4 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via malformed U3D data in a PDF document, related to a CLODProgressiveMeshDeclaration "array boundary issue," a different vulnerability than CVE-2009-2994. | 8.8 |
2009-11-11 | CVE-2009-3129 |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Microsoft products Microsoft Office Excel 2002 SP3, 2003 SP3, and 2007 SP1 and SP2; Office 2004 and 2008 for Mac; Open XML File Format Converter for Mac; Office Excel Viewer 2003 SP3; Office Excel Viewer SP1 and SP2; and Office Compatibility Pack for Word, Excel, and PowerPoint 2007 File Formats SP1 and SP2 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a spreadsheet with a FEATHEADER record containing an invalid cbHdrData size element that affects a pointer offset, aka "Excel Featheader Record Memory Corruption Vulnerability." | 7.8 |
